Job Duties

  • Cook and prepare meals as per standardized recipes and guidelines for production
  • organize workstations with the required ingredients and equipment for the job
  • organize ingredients by chopping, trimming, measuring, mixing, and other necessary steps
  • properly use various kitchen utensils and equipment, such as knives, ovens, stoves, and mixers, to ensure safety in the kitchen
  • make meals by using methods such as baking, broiling, roasting, and steaming to cook various dishes
  • arrange, adorn, and serve food in a manner that meets prescribed criteria for its visual display
  • adhere to the prescribed food safety procedures and store food items adequately
  • purify and sanitize kitchen zones, equipment, and utensils to prevent contamination
  • ensure excellent customer support and sustain a cheerful attitude
  • abide by all safety and sanitation measures outlined by Aramark
  • preserve the integrity of company assets
